The family of Grey’s Anatomy star Eric Dane announced his passing aged 53 on Thursday (19 February) in a heartbreaking statement.
Dane, who had been diagnosed with the rare degenerative disease, amyotrophic lateral sclerosis (ALS), is survived by his wife, Rebecca Gayheart, and their two daughters, Billie and Georgia.
The grieving family confirmed the news in a statement to PEOPLE, which reads: "With heavy hearts, we share that Eric Dane passed on Thursday afternoon following a courageous battle with ALS.
"He spent his final days surrounded by dear friends, his devoted wife, and his two beautiful daughters, Billie and Georgia, who were the center of his world.
"Throughout his journey with ALS, Eric became a passionate advocate for awareness and research, determined to make a difference for others facing the same fight."
The message concluded: "He will be deeply missed and lovingly remembered always. Eric adored his fans and is forever grateful for the outpouring of love and support he’s received. The family has asked for privacy as they navigate this impossible time."

In April last year, Dane revealed he had been diagnosed with ALS, a rare degenerative form of motor neurone disease. It leads to muscle weakness in the arms and legs, often causing people to trip or struggle to hold onto things.
Symptoms vary from person to person, depending on which nerve cells are affected. In most cases, it begins with mild muscle weakness that gradually spreads and becomes more severe over time.
Dane's wife opened up about their relationship just one day before Dane announced his diagnosis back in April last year.
The former Beverly Hills, 90210 star's comments also came a month after she filed to dismiss her 2018 divorce from Dane.
He agreed to the filing, and a court in Los Angeles later closed the case, according to documents obtained by E!.

Speaking with E! News at the time, Gayheart said the two were 'best friends'.
After calling off their divorce, she explained: "We are really close. We are great coparents.
"We really figured out the formula to staying a family, and I think our kids are benefiting greatly from i,t and we are as well."
The American model also reflected on their marriage and why she doesn't believe their relationship is a 'failure', adding: "I think it’s important to not look at a relationship that ends as a failure. It's just a season.
"It wasn't a failure. It was a huge success."
Talking about perspective, the mum-of-two added: "We were married for, I mean, we are still married, but together for 15 years and we had two beautiful kids, so I think that's a successful relationship, and that's how we look at it."
